Quality signals versus empty quizzes

In hiring, use results as one conversation input, not a single gate. Pair with interviews and real performance history.

Check whether the provider states test edition, sample size, and whether scores use percentiles or bands. Without that context, comparing prices is comparing pretty screens.

Ask plainly about privacy: what they store, whether leads are resold, and how fast accounts delete. A cognitive screen should not demand absurd permissions.

For children, confirm age instructions and adult supervision. Motivation and reading skill sway short tests more than people expect.

Before paying for a printable certificate, verify date, method, and a link to acceptable use. Some PDFs are decorative only.

A monthly plan can make sense if you reassess profiles often; a one-time fee is usually enough for a single school or hiring decision. Watch for surprise auto-renewals.

Does an online test replace a clinical evaluation?

No. An educational screen measures visual reasoning for learning context—it does not diagnose disorders.

How long does a typical session take?

Most matrix-style runs take ten to twenty-five minutes with steady focus. Long breaks can distort comparison.

What does a paid certificate actually add?

It should show date, method, and a cautiously interpreted range—useful as voluntary documentation, not a regulated credential.
